These are images of posters that could have been seen all over China during the time of the Cultural Revolution which lasted from 1966 until 1976. In the years following the turmoil of this period, most of the posters were destroyed.

Due to a new resurgence of patriotism in China, a kind of nostalgia is brining these relics into the mainstream. Some trends are using them for wallpaper, upholstery and curtains- to name a few. Corporations are taking certain aspects of the posters and using them as logos.
